Alguém poderia me ajudar?

Desejo implementar as operações: subtração, mutiplicação, divisão, sin(seno) e randon. No seguinte código abaixo.
Alguém pode me dizer como fazer?

import java.lang.Math;
public class Calculadora {
/*
*atributos
*/

private boolean cientifica;


/*
 * construtor
 */
public Calculadora(boolean eCientifica){
	setCientifica(eCientifica);
}
public Calculadora(){
	setCientifica(false);
}

/*
 * classes
 */

public double soma(double a, double b){
	return a + b;
}
public double potencia(double a, double b){
	return Math.pow(a,b);
}


/*
 * metodo get e set
 */
public boolean isCientifica() {
	return cientifica;
}



public void setCientifica(boolean cientifica) {
	this.cientifica = cientifica;
}

/*
 * metodo main
 */

public static void main(String[] args) {
	Calculadora calc = new Calculadora(false);
	System.out.println(calc.soma(3.18, 6.5));
    System.out.println(calc.potencia(3,2));
    
    Calculadora calc2;
    calc2 = new Calculadora();
}

}

Qual exatamente o problema com esse código???

obs.: cuidado com o lugar onde você posta suas dúvidas, algum moderador pode não gostar. Esse tipo de tópico ficaria melhor do fórum “Java Básico”

T+

da uma olhada aqui antes de postar seus codigos…

http://www.guj.com.br/posts/list/125997.java

Verdade. Sorte que podemos mover tópicos. \o/

Aproveite também e use as tags code na hora de postar. Se ainda não sabe fazer isso, leia:
http://www.guj.com.br/posts/list/50115.java